Creating an Array: Difference between revisions

→‎Delphi: Delete.
(→‎C++: Delete everything except Qt and MFC.)
(→‎Delphi: Delete.)
Line 247:
// static array
int[5] numbers = [0,1,2,3,4];</lang>
 
==[[Delphi]]==
'''Defining a variable-length array'''
<lang delphi>var
i: integer;
a: array of integer;
begin
readln(i);
SetLength(a, i); { create array }
a[0] := 2; { use it }
if high(a) = i
then
writeln('I expected that.');
else
writeln('Get a better compiler!');
finalize(a);
end</lang>
Delphi dynamic arrays have base 0 index.
 
==[[Fortran]]==
Anonymous user